Last Updated at 11 October 2024GOVT URDU LOWER PRIMARY SCHOOL HALENAHALLI: A Rural Educational Hub in Karnataka
GOVT URDU LOWER PRIMARY SCHOOL HALENAHALLI, located in the Sira block of the Tumakuru Madhugiri district in Karnataka, stands as a testament to the commitment to education in rural India. Established in 1930, this government-managed school caters to students from Grades 1 to 5, providing a valuable learning environment for children in the surrounding community.
The school offers a co-educational learning experience, with a focus on Urdu as the medium of instruction. The curriculum, designed for primary education, aims to provide students with a strong foundation in foundational skills and knowledge. Notably, the school is not attached to a pre-primary section, suggesting a dedicated focus on primary education.
The school building itself is a testament to the dedication of the institution. It boasts a total of one classroom, ensuring a conducive learning environment for the students. The school also features a dedicated room for the head teacher, further emphasizing the importance of leadership and guidance in the educational process.
In addition to the classroom, the school boasts a range of facilities that enhance the learning experience. A well-maintained playground provides space for physical activity and social interaction, fostering a healthy and active school environment. The school also has a library, housing an impressive collection of 115 books, offering students access to a wealth of knowledge and encouraging a love for reading.
The school prioritizes the safety and well-being of its students, evident in the presence of functional toilets, separate for boys and girls. The school also boasts a reliable tap water source for clean and accessible drinking water, ensuring the health and hygiene of its students.
The school's commitment to accessibility is further highlighted by the presence of ramps for disabled children. These ramps ensure that all students, regardless of their abilities, can access the classrooms and participate fully in the learning process.
The school's dedication to providing a comprehensive educational experience is further underscored by its provision of midday meals. Although prepared off-site, the school ensures that students receive nutritious meals, contributing to their overall well-being and their ability to focus on their studies.
While the school does not have computers or a computer-aided learning lab, it highlights the need for further technological integration to provide students with access to modern learning tools and resources.
